Contents:
Cover; Making Saints inModernChina; Copyright; Contents; Preface; List of Contributors; Introduction; 1. The Charismatic Monk and the Chanting Masses:Master Yinguang and His Pure Land Revival Movement; 2. Zhang Yuanxu:The Making and Unmaking of a Daoist Saint ; 3. Chan Master Xuyun:The Embodiment of an Ideal, The Transmission of a Model; 4. Duan Zhengyuan and the Moral Studies Society:"Religionized Confucianism" during the Republican Period; 5. Two Turns in the Life of Master Hongyi, ABuddhist Monk in Twentieth-century
6. Yiguandao's Patriarch Zhang Tianran:Hagiography, Deification, and Production of Charisma in a Modern Religious Organization7. Sainthood, Science, and Politics:The Life of Li Yujie, Founder of the Tiandijiao; 8. Subtle Erudition and Compassionate Devotion:Longlian, "The Most Outstanding Bhiksuni" in Modern China; 9. Comrade Zhao Puchu:Bodhisattva under the Red Flag; 10. The "New Clothes" of Sainthood in China:The Case of Nan Huaijin; 11. Jingkong:From Universal Saint to Sectarian Saint; 12. Ren Fajiu:ALiving Daoist Immortal in the People's Republic? ; Bibliography; Index
